Zanjan (About this sound pronunciation Persian: زنجان, Azerbaijani: زنگان ,Zәngan, Zәncan ) is the capital of Zanjan Province in northwestern Iran. It lies 298 km (185 mi) north-west of Tehran on the main highway to Tabriz and Turkey and approximately 125 km (78 mi) from the Caspian Sea. The city is located about 20 kilometers south of the Qaflankuh Mountain Range. At the 2011 census, its population was 386,851, which is the 20th largest city in Iran.
